The significance of learning current affairs and politics
First of all, the current political education cultivates students' abilities of autonomous learning and cooperative learning, as well as their abilities of collecting and processing information, acquiring new knowledge, analyzing and solving problems. It has aroused students' learning enthusiasm and promoted the deepening of ideological and political teaching reform.

Second, carry out current affairs and political education, broaden students' horizons, actively guide students to look at social reality in an all-round way, and help students form a good and healthy psychology and a positive attitude towards life. Promote middle school students to establish correct positions and viewpoints, form correct world outlook, outlook on life and values, and improve their comprehensive quality.

Third, carry out current affairs and political education, give full play to the educational function of ideological and political courses, and improve students' ideological and political consciousness. Teaching with current events, connecting with hot issues that students care about, guiding students to analyze political, economic and social phenomena with Marxist standpoint, thinking about world outlook, outlook on life and values, and clarifying vague understanding of the situation and policies are conducive to improving students' ideological and political consciousness and enhancing their sense of social responsibility.

Fourthly, it is convenient for students to learn current politics, deepen students' understanding of the line, principles and policies of the party and the country, promote the implementation of national principles and policies, realize the ruling concept of "people-oriented" of the China * * * production party, and firmly follow the socialist belief of the * * * production party.

A US Treasury spokesman said on the 5th that according to the US Overseas Account Tax Compliance Act (referred to as the Compliance Act) promulgated on 20 10, the United States has reached a substantive agreement with the Singapore government on tax information sharing, and a formal intergovernmental agreement is expected to be signed before the end of the year. Earlier, the United States had reached similar intergovernmental agreements with more than 60 countries and regions, including Switzerland.

3. The International Comparison Project of the World Bank released a research result. According to the purchasing power parity method, the economic scale of China will surpass that of the United States in 20 14, ranking first in the world. Once this achievement was released, it immediately attracted great attention from international public opinion.
